3 tablespoons dry white wine
3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
1 1/2 tablespoons low-sodium soy sauce
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 1/2 teaspoons olive oil
1 garlic clove, minced
4 (6-ounce) salmon fillets (about 1 inch thick)
Cooking spray
Sliced green onions (optional)
Combine the first 6 ingredients in a large zip-top plastic bag. Add salmon to bag; seal. Marinate in refrigerator 40 minutes, turning once.
Prepare grill.
Remove fish from bag, and reserve marinade. Place fish on grill rack coated with cooking spray, skin side down; grill 5 minutes. Brush fish with reserved marinade; discard remaining marinade. Lightly coat fish with cooking spray. Turn fish over; grill 3 minutes or until fish flakes easily when tested with a fork. Garnish with onions, if desired.
*Make sure to coat the fish with cooking spray before turning it so it won't stick to the grill.
